Colour woodblock print, Geisha and boy with kite by Totoya Hokkei, printed in Japan, 1820. Shikishiban format, surimono print prepared for the Go group with poem signed GanshÅan Michitsura. Calendar information is included in one of the two votive slips (senjafuda) pasted to the shrine.
